Total laparoscopic hysterectomy for uteri over one kilogram

Abstract

Introduction: Laparoscopic hysterectomy for large fibroid uteri is technically a difficult procedure. In this article, we report our experience with fibroid uteri >1 kg in weight.

Materials and methods: An intent-to-treat study.

Results: From 2003 to 2009, 13 patients were successfully treated for large fibroid uteri with postoperative specimens weighing >1000 g. Four patients had total abdominal hysterectomy, one patient had laparoscopically assisted vaginal hysterectomy, and 8 patients had total laparoscopic hysterectomy. The last 6 cases were total laparoscopic hysterectomy cases.

Conclusion: With experience and specialized techniques, total laparoscopic hysterectomy can replace abdominal hysterectomy for large uteri.
